Ash Cannula 16G Intravenous Catheter

The Ash Cannula 16G is a large-bore IV catheter engineered for emergency medicine, trauma care, critical resuscitation, and surgical procedures. With its 16-gauge size, it delivers a high flow rate, making it ideal when rapid fluid replacement, blood transfusion, or medication infusion is urgently required.

Constructed from biocompatible, medical-grade materials, the Ash Cannula 16G ensures smooth insertion, reduced vein trauma, and dependable vascular access. Its ash/grey color-coded hub follows the universal IV cannula identification system, allowing healthcare professionals to quickly recognize and select the correct gauge in fast-paced settings.
